A vulnerability in the web-based management interface of Cisco AsyncOS Software for Cisco Secure Email Gateway could allow an authenticated, remote attacker to conduct an XSS attack against a user of the interface.r This vulnerability is due to insufficient validation of user input.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by persuading a user of an affected interface to click a crafted link.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to execute arbitrary script code in the context of the affected interface or access sensitive, browser-based information.

CVE-2024-20257 is rated as a critical severity vulnerability due to its potential to allow an authenticated remote attacker to execute an XSS attack.
To fix CVE-2024-20257, update your Cisco AsyncOS Software for Cisco Secure Email Gateway to the latest version that addresses this vulnerability.
CVE-2024-20257 affects users of the web-based management interface for Cisco AsyncOS Software for Cisco Secure Email Gateway.
An attacker exploiting CVE-2024-20257 could conduct c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ks against users of the affected web interface.
Currently, there are no official workarounds for CVE-2024-20257; updating the software is the recommended action.
